The Legal Obligations of North Kingstown Recreation Departments Under TCPA
The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A) imposes significant legal obligations on businesses, including North Kingstown Recreation Departments, when it comes to automated calls and text messages. As a lawyer for TCPA Rhode Island, I’ve seen many cases involving parks and recreation services that have inadvertently run afoul of these regulations. The act restricts the use of prerecorded or artificial voices, as well as automatic dialing systems, for marketing purposes without prior express consent from the recipient. This means that if the department uses automated technology to announce park events, they must ensure compliance with TCPA guidelines. Failure to do so can result in substantial fines and legal repercussions.
North Kingstown Recreation Departments must obtain explicit permission from individuals before sending any promotional messages related to park events. This consent should be freely given, specific to the purpose of receiving event announcements, and easily revocable. Departments should also implement robust internal policies and procedures to manage call lists, track consent preferences, and monitor compliance with TCPA standards. Regularly reviewing and updating these practices is crucial to stay ahead of changing legal landscapes and protect both the department’s interests and the rights of citizens within their community.
Key Exclusions and Safe Harbors for Park Event Announcements
The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A) provides significant protections for consumers, but it also includes key exclusions and safe harbors, especially when it comes to park event announcements. One notable exclusion is for messages that are not considered telemarketing in nature. This means that informational communications related to events or activities in public parks are generally exempt from TCPA restrictions. For instance, a North Kingstown Recreation Department can notify residents about upcoming community events without worrying about compliance issues.
Additionally, the TCPA offers safe harbors for certain types of messages. If park event announcements are not made using automated dialing systems or prerecorded messages, they fall outside the scope of TCPA regulations. This includes personal and direct communication methods, ensuring that recreation departments have flexibility in reaching their audiences. Implementing Effective Compliance Strategies: Tips for Recreation Departments
Implementing effective compliance strategies is crucial for North Kingstown Recreation Departments navigating the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A) when organizing park events. A key step is ensuring explicit consent from attendees, especially when utilizing automated phone systems or text messaging for event announcements. Engaging visitors to opt-in through clear and concise opt-in forms at registration or entry points can help build a compliant participant list.
Additionally, departments should maintain thorough records of consent, including the method of collection and documentation of each attendee’s agreement. Regularly reviewing and updating consent procedures with input from a lawyer for TCPA Rhode Island ensures ongoing adherence to legal standards. This proactive approach not only mitigates potential legal issues but also fosters open communication with the community, enhancing the overall event experience.
